The Indian Agricultural Research Institute (IARI) recently concluded an impactful six-day Agripreneurship Development Program (ADP) titled “From Seed to Storage: Ensuring Quality in Field and Vegetable Crops”, highlighting innovative approaches in hybrid seed production for vegetable crops in India. This program, conducted from September 22 to 27, 2025, aimed at equipping participants with essential knowledge on seed quality assurance—a cornerstone of sustainable agriculture and food security.

Key Highlights of the Agripreneurship Development Program

The program provided a comprehensive curriculum covering various aspects of hybrid seed production:

  • Male Sterility Mechanisms in Hybrid Vegetable Seed Production: Participants explored techniques for controlling pollination to achieve uniform and high-quality hybrids.
  • Seed Quality Improvement with Modern Technologies: Advanced diagnostic methods were demonstrated to detect seed-borne pathogens, ensuring disease-free seed stock.
  • Post-Harvest Handling Techniques for Vegetable Hybrid Seeds: Emphasis was placed on storage, moisture management, and longevity to maintain seed viability.
  • Regulatory Requirements for Hybrid Seed Certification in India: Understanding certification standards ensures compliance and market readiness.
  • Entrepreneurship in Hybrid Vegetable Seed Production in India: The program encouraged participants to explore commercial opportunities, bridging the gap between scientific knowledge and business acumen.

Hands-On Field and Industrial Exposure

IARI’s ADP provided participants with practical exposure through field and industrial visits. At the IARI campus in Pusa, New Delhi, participants observed real-world seed production processes and engaged with experienced scientists. An industrial visit in Haryana offered insights into large-scale seed production operations, bridging academic theory with industry practices.

These visits reinforced the significance of precision in hybrid seed production for vegetable crops in India, from selecting parent lines to ensuring high-quality seed output for commercial use.

Valedictory Session and Future Opportunities

The program concluded with a valedictory ceremony on September 26, 2025, graced by Dr. D K Yadav, Deputy Director General (Crop Science), ICAR. Dr. Yadav appreciated the enthusiasm of participants and reiterated the importance of hybrid seed production for vegetable crops in India as a tool for agricultural innovation and entrepreneurship. He also highlighted several government schemes and support mechanisms available for budding seed entrepreneurs.

FAQs

  1. What is hybrid seed production for vegetable crops in India?
    Hybrid seed production for vegetable crops in India involves controlled pollination and seed quality management to produce high-yielding, uniform crops.
  2. Why is male sterility important in hybrid vegetable seed production?
    Male sterility mechanisms help prevent self-pollination, ensuring uniform hybrid seeds with desired traits.
  3. How can post-harvest handling techniques improve vegetable hybrid seeds?
    Proper storage, moisture control, and handling techniques enhance seed longevity, germination rates, and crop performance.
  4. What regulatory requirements exist for hybrid seed certification in India?
    Seeds must comply with national quality standards, undergo physical and genetic purity tests, and be certified for commercial distribution.
